David F. Mota has authored 176 papers that have received a total of 9.6k indexed citations.
This includes 174 papers in Astronomy and Astrophysics, 123 papers in Nuclear and High Energy Physics and 16 papers in Statistical and Nonlinear Physics. The topics of these papers are Cosmology and Gravitation Theories (166 papers), Galaxies: Formation, Evolution, Phenomena (91 papers) and Black Holes and Theoretical Physics (76 papers). David F. Mota is often cited by papers focused on Cosmology and Gravitation Theories (166 papers), Galaxies: Formation, Evolution, Phenomena (91 papers) and Black Holes and Theoretical Physics (76 papers) and collaborates with scholars based in Norway, United Kingdom and Germany. David F. Mota's co-authors include Tomi S. Koivisto, Claudio Llinares, Hans A. Winther, Baojiu Li and Douglas J. Shaw and has published in prestigious journals such as Physical Review Letters, The Astrophysical Journal and Monthly Notices of the Royal Astronomical Society.
